Common Residential & Commercial Roofing Scams in Wayland

Be aware of these tactic used by unlicensed operators

🚫

Storm Chaser

After bad weather, out-of-area crews swarm Wayland homes. They spot 'loose shingles' from the street, demand big deposits for 'urgent' fixes, then disappear or botch the job.

🚫

Bait-and-Switch

Ultra-low bid for a simple repair. Once on roof, they 'discover' major issues needing full replacement at triple the price.

🚫

Material Switcheroo

Promise premium shingles, but install cheap knockoffs. They pocket the difference and vanish when questioned.

🚫

Phantom Payment

Work starts, then 'foreman' demands cash mid-job for 'unexpected costs.' No receipts, and they walk if not paid.

How to Verify a Professional

1

Insurance

Request a full certificate of insurance (COI) for general liability and workers' compensation. Call the insurance provider using the number on the certificate—not the one given by the contractor—to confirm coverage and limits. Ensure it names you as an additional insured for the job.

2

Licensing

New York State does not require a statewide roofing license, but local rules apply in Wayland and Steuben County. Contact the Wayland Building Department or Steuben County offices to check for required permits or registrations. Always ask for their license number and verify it directly.

3

References

Insist on 3-5 recent references from local Wayland or Steuben County roofing jobs. Call each one to ask about work quality, timeliness, cleanup, and if they'd rehire. Check independent review sites for patterns.

Protection FAQs

Do roofers need a license in Wayland, NY?

NY State has no roofing license requirement, but Wayland and Steuben County may mandate local permits. Always verify with the building department.

Is it normal to pay upfront for roofing?

A small deposit (10-30%) is common, but never full payment before work starts. Tie payments to milestones like materials delivery or completion.

What if a roofer shows up unannounced after a storm?

Be very wary—these are often storm chasers. Take photos of damage, call your insurer, and seek vetted local pros.

How do I confirm insurance is real?

Get a COI and call the insurer directly. Check expiration and coverage amounts match your job.

Can I trust verbal promises for warranties?

No—get everything in a detailed written contract. Specify workmanship and material warranties.

What if I think I've been scammed?

Stop payments, document everything, report to Wayland police, NY Attorney General, and BBB. Contact your credit card if paid that way.
